Transgender widow loses fight for husbands death benefits
WHARTON, Texas – A Wharton County judge on Tuesday declared that a transgender widow’s marriage to a fallen Wharton firefighter was not valid, so she is not eligible for his death benefits.

Former right wing radio host tells mother he is afraid for his life
Hal Turner a former ultra-conservative right wing internet radio pundit is afraid he may be assassinated in prison. Turner, who built a sizeable following among white supremacists, was an active blogger and it was his blogging that landed him behind bars after being convicted on charges that he used his blog to intimidate and retaliate against federal judges who issued rulings that upheld local handgun bans in Chicago.

Blast by Colt 45 rejected by store owner, feels it targets youth.
Boulder liquor sellers reject 'binge-in-a-can' Blast by Colt 45
On the heels of a request by 17 attorneys general that Pabst Brewing Company stop making a new malt beverage that packs nearly five servings of alcohol into one 23.5-ounce can, several Boulder-area liquor sellers have declined to stock Blast by Colt 45.

Schwarzenegger admits to affair, fathers child with household staff member
Former California Gov. Arnold Schwarzenegger and his wife, Maria Shriver, separated after she learned he had fathered a child more than a decade ago -- before his first run for office -- with a longtime member of their household staff.
